Core Innovation
This paper introduces MoWorld, a World Model built on a scalable 3D-native data engine enabling geometrically consistent training data generation. It employs a curriculum cross-frame pre-training strategy and an efficient denoising-step distillation algorithm to reduce training cost. MoWorld also features a mixed-precision parallel inference framework optimized for NPUs, achieving up to 50 FPS real-time interaction with reduced inference cost.

Research Paper Overview
MoWorld: A Flash World Model
Summary
MoWorld is a cost-effective, high-performance World Model enabling real-time interaction at up to 50 FPS on low-cost NPUs without high-end GPUs. It uses a scalable 3D-native data engine and efficient training and inference techniques to reduce costs and improve deployment practicality for large-scale real-world applications.
